Join our team and help build the next generation of low-power verification software for the Palladium and Protium emulation and prototyping platforms.
As a Lead Software Engineer - Low Power Verification you will be responsible for improving the performance and usability of UPF debug features, adding support for new IEEE 1801 LRM revisions, and rebuilding UPF documentation around end-to-end workflows for multi-billion-gate low-power designs.
What you will do:
Enhance UPF debug features -- improve performance and usability across the Parallel Partition Compiler (PPC) and Modular Compiler (MC) flows, including Dielet UPF support.
Scale UPF event logging and violation detection – apply new techniques to capture and report more UPF events, with better multi-billion-gate low-power designs.
Rebuild UPF documentation around end-to-end debug scenarios and workflows, backed by valid SystemVerilog and UPF examples.
Help develop AI-assisted UPF debug tools to reduce time-to-root-cause for low-power design issues.
Work with R&D, PE and AE teams to deploy UPF solutions across key flows (AVIP, UVMA, MC, and Dielets -- each with UPF in 2- and 4-state).
Help consolidate and unify UPF debug across Palladium and Protium.

What We Do
Cadence enables electronic systems and semiconductor companies to create the innovative end products that are transforming the way people live, work and play. Cadence® software, hardware and IP are used by customers to deliver products to market faster. The company's Intelligent System Design strategy helps customers develop differentiated products—from chips to boards to intelligent systems—in mobile, consumer, cloud, data center, automotive, aerospace, IoT, industrial and other market segments.
